We Tried Starbucks' New Chocolate Cream Cold Brew

On May 10, Starbucks' launched their menu items for Summer. We couldn’t resist doing a review of their new drink: the Chocolate Cream Cold Brew.

What Is the Chocolate Cream Cold Brew?

The base is cold brew (which, no, is not just iced coffee), and it's sweetened with vanilla syrup. The real kicker is the chocolate cold foam on top.

What Does It Taste Like?

The official Starbucks description states that the cold foam is "chocolaty," and we would have to agree with that phrasing.

The first sip was nice, with mellow chocolate undertones. Then the vanilla syrup came through more strongly than expected.

But, as we continued sipping, the already mild chocolate flavor became even more diluted. Overall, it's tasty, but not super chocolatey. We think adding a pump of mocha sauce might help.

How Many Calories Does It Have?

We don't generally care about calorie info, but if you're curious, the grande version of the Chocolate Cream Cold Brew has 250 calories.
